Determining the Vertex of a Production Cost Curve

An operations manager has determined that the axis of symmetry for a production cost curve modeled by the equation y=ax2+bx+cy = ax^2 + bx + c is x=10x = 10. To find the yy-coordinate of the vertex (the point of minimum cost), what specific algebraic step must the manager perform next?
